Rental Car Return Location at Tampa International Airport
Tampa International Airport has a dedicated rental car center located just a short ride away from the main terminal. The Rental Car Center is easily accessible via the complimentary TPA Connect shuttle service, which runs 24/7. Most major rental car companies operate from this centralized location, making it convenient for travelers to return their vehicles.
When returning your car, follow the signs for the Rental Car Center and proceed to the designated drop-off area for your specific rental company. It's crucial to confirm the exact location and drop-off instructions with your rental provider beforehand to avoid any confusion.
Shuttle Service Details
- The TPA Connect shuttle operates every 10-15 minutes.
- Look for the shuttle stop signs near the baggage claim area.
- The ride to the Rental Car Center typically takes around 5-10 minutes.

Potential Fees to Be Aware Of
While most rental car companies are transparent about their fees, it's important to be aware of potential charges that could arise during the return process:
- Refueling Fees: Many companies charge a premium for refueling if the tank is not full upon return.
- Damage Fees: Any visible damage to the vehicle may result in repair charges.
- Cleaning Fees: A dirty car interior or exterior may incur additional cleaning costs.
- Late Return Fees: Returning the car after the agreed-upon time can result in additional charges.
Review your rental agreement carefully to understand the fee structure and avoid surprises.
Timing and Operating Hours
The Rental Car Center at Tampa International Airport operates 24 hours a day to accommodate all travelers. However, the availability of customer service representatives may vary depending on the time of day. If you plan to return your car during off-peak hours, consider using self-service options or contacting your rental company in advance to confirm their procedures.
Peak Hours for Rental Car Returns
Be prepared for longer wait times during peak travel hours, typically in the late afternoon and early evening. Arriving earlier or later in the day can help you avoid crowds and expedite the return process.

Frequently Asked Questions About Rental Car Return
Can I Return My Rental Car at a Different Location?
Yes, many rental car companies allow one-way rentals, but additional fees may apply. Confirm the details and costs with your provider before booking.
What Happens If I Return the Car Late?
Returning the car late may result in additional charges based on the rental company's policy. Always aim to return the vehicle within the agreed-upon timeframe.
Do I Need to Refuel the Car Before Returning It?
Some rental agreements require you to return the car with a full tank, while others include a refueling service for a fee. Check your contract to understand the requirements.
